Project Title: Property Maintenance Services
Description: The Housing & Neighborhoods Department is seeking a contractor to provide ongoing maintenance for its portfolio of vacant lots. Services may include, but are not limited to lawn care, landscaping, small tree removal, litter and debris pickup, bulk item and junk removal, and sign installation.
